When editing a PDF the font changes to: Z@R1A65.tmp without asking.
This just started doing this the past days. My default Font is Arial.
I have Acrobat Pro XI version 11.0.23.

This issue happens as sometimes when printing a file to pdf using Acrobat pro or Reader apps, it leaves behind some temporary fonts in the window temp folder location which is C:\Users\<username>\AppData\Local\Temp
if you look there you will find these files with names similar to Z@R3A.tmp, Z@R3C.tmp, Z@R1A65 etc.
So to fix the issue, please close your Acrobat application,
then go to the temp folder (C:\Users\<username>\AppData\Local\Temp) and delete these files and try editing again.
This should fix the issue.
